Product description

Immerse yourself in the enchanting world of Frederick Delius with this captivating album, "Frederick Delius, Brigg Fair." Released on February 16, 2009, this collection showcases the brilliance of Delius's orchestral compositions, spanning a rich and varied repertoire that highlights his unique musical voice.

The album opens with the title track, "Brigg Fair," a set of variations on an English folk song collected by Delius's friend, the Australian composer Percy Grainger. This piece, subtitled "An English Rhapsody," is a testament to Delius's ability to weave traditional melodies into intricate and evocative orchestral arrangements. The folk song, which tells the story of a young man journeying to a fair to meet his sweetheart, is transformed into a lush and romantic orchestral work that captures the essence of rural England.

Throughout the album, Delius's impressionistic style shines, with pieces like "Koanga," "Hassan," and "The Walk to the Paradise Garden" showcasing his mastery of orchestration and his penchant for creating atmospheric and evocative soundscapes. "Koanga," inspired by Delius's time in Florida, blends exotic rhythms and lush harmonies, while "Hassan" draws on Middle Eastern influences to create a serene and mystical atmosphere. "The Walk to the Paradise Garden," taken from Delius's opera "A Village Romeo and Juliet," is a poignant and lyrical piece that underscores the composer's deep connection to nature and the human experience.

The album also features lesser-known works, such as "2 Pieces for Small Orchestra" and "Over the Hills and Far Away," which demonstrate Delius's versatility and his ability to create compelling music on a smaller scale. Each piece on this album is a testament to Delius's unique vision and his enduring legacy as one of the most innovative and influential composers of the early 20th century.

About Frederick Delius

Frederick Delius, born into a wealthy mercantile family in Bradford, England, was a composer who defied conventional paths. Rather than following his family's wishes to enter the world of commerce, Delius pursued his passion for music. In 1884, he was sent to Florida to manage an orange plantation, but his heart was not in the business. Instead, he immersed himself in the local music and culture, which significantly influenced his compositions. Returning to Europe in 1886, Delius dedicated himself to his true calling, creating a body of work that reflects his unique experiences and artistic vision.
